>> +bool APInt::extractBit(unsigned bitPosition) const {
>> +  assert(bitPosition < BitWidth && "Out of the bit-width range!");
>> +  if (isSingleWord())
>> +    return VAL & maskBit(bitPosition);
>> +  else
>> +    return pVal[whichWord(bitPosition)] & maskBit(bitPosition);
>> +}
